SSC JE Recruitment 2026 — 1,748 Vacancies, Apply Online by 22 September 2026

The Staff Selection Commission (SSC) has officially released the SSC JE 2026 Notification on 2 September 2026 on its official website ssc.gov.in. A total of 1,748 vacancies (Tentative) have been announced for Junior Engineer (Civil, Mechanical, Electrical, Telecom) posts and Scientific Assistant posts in the India Meteorological Department, across several Central Government organisations.

This is one of the most closely watched technical recruitment drives of the year for engineering diploma and degree holders. Eligible candidates can submit their online applications from 2 September 2026 to 22 September 2026 through the official SSC candidate portal.

Candidates are advised to read the complete notification carefully before applying, as eligibility conditions — educational qualification, age limit, and experience requirements — vary by department and post.

How to Apply Online — Step by Step

1) Visit the official SSC website: https://ssc.gov.in
2) If you are a new user, complete the One-Time Registration (OTR) process: provide Name, Father’s Name, Mother’s Name, Date of Birth, Class 10 details, and Aadhaar Number, then note your Registration ID and Password.
3) Log in to the SSC portal using your OTR Registration ID and Password.
4) Click on Apply and select Junior Engineer (JE) Examination 2026 from the list of active notifications.
5) Fill in the application form carefully — personal details, educational qualifications, category, and preferred post/department.
6) Upload required documents: recent passport-size photograph, signature, and category/disability certificate where applicable.
7) Pay the application fee (₹100 for General/OBC/EWS; Nil for others) through UPI, Net Banking, or Debit/Credit Card.
8) Review the filled form carefully before final submission. Corrections are only possible during the correction window (28–30 September 2026).
9) Submit the application and download/print the confirmation page for future reference.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

What is the last date to apply for SSC JE 2026?

The last date to submit the online application is 22 September 2026. The last date to pay the application fee is 23 September 2026.

How many total vacancies have been released in SSC JE 2026?

A total of 1,748 vacancies (tentative) have been announced for Junior Engineer and Scientific Assistant posts. Final department-wise vacancies will be released separately.

What is the age limit for SSC JE 2026?

The age limit is generally 18 to 30 years, extending up to 32 years for certain departments such as CPWD and DGLL. Age relaxation applies as per government norms for reserved categories.

What is the application fee for SSC JE 2026?

General, OBC and EWS candidates must pay ₹100. Women, SC/ST, PwBD and Ex-Servicemen candidates are exempt from the fee.

What is the selection process for SSC JE 2026?

Selection is based on Paper 1 (qualifying CBT), Paper 2 (merit-based CBT), and Document Verification. There is no interview.

What is the eligibility for SSC JE 2026?

Candidates must hold a Diploma or Degree in the relevant Engineering discipline, or a Science/Engineering degree for the Scientific Assistant post, as specified department-wise in the official notification.

When is the SSC JE 2026 Paper 1 exam expected?

Paper 1 is tentatively scheduled for October to November 2026. Exact dates will be notified separately on the official SSC website.
